Cognitive Improvements in Sinking Skin Flap Syndrome Using a Negative Pressure Helmet.

Sinking skin flap syndrome, a complication after decompressive craniectomy, can be temporarily managed with a negative-pressure helmet. This novel approach relieved brain mass effect, prolonging survival and improving cognitive function in a patient.

Background:
- Sinking skin flap syndrome (Syndrome of the Trephined) is a rare complication post-decompressive craniectomy.
- Characterized by neurological deficits exacerbated by atmospheric pressure changes.
- Standard long-term treatment is cranioplasty, with temporary measures needed when immediate cranioplasty is not feasible.
